Concrete Flatwork Repair in Miami Dade County, FL
Concrete flatwork repair services address issues with existing concrete surfaces such as driveways, patios, walkways, and garage floors. This service involves fixing cracks, uneven surfaces, and damaged areas to restore the safety, appearance, and functionality of the concrete. Property owners often seek these repairs to prevent further deterioration, improve curb appeal, or prepare a surface for additional projects. It’s important for homeowners to understand the extent of damage, the type of repair needed, and the condition of the existing concrete before requesting services, ensuring the best approach for long-lasting results.
Before requesting concrete flatwork repair, property owners should consider factors like the age of the concrete, the severity of cracks or damage, and whether there are underlying issues such as soil movement or drainage problems. Clear communication about the scope of the repair, including surface preparation and finishing preferences, can help ensure the work meets expectations. Proper assessment and planning are essential to achieve a durable, smooth, and visually appealing finished surface that aligns with the property’s needs.

Concrete Flatwork Repair Questions
What types of concrete flatwork repairs are common? Common repairs include fixing cracks, surface spalling, uneven slabs, and joint deterioration to restore stability and appearance.
How can I tell if my concrete needs repair? Signs such as large cracks, sinking sections, or surface scaling indicate that concrete repair may be necessary to prevent further damage.
What benefits come from repairing concrete flatwork? Repairing extends the lifespan of the concrete, improves safety, and enhances the property's curb appeal.
What surfaces are typically repaired in flatwork projects? Driveways, sidewalks, patios, and pool decks are common surfaces that may require flatwork repair services.
